summ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orChristopher Arndt2022-08-14 15:32:08 +0200
committerChristopher Arndt2022-08-14 15:32:08 +0200
commit35047654dd91c490eb906dc4f40715bbfce7f466 (patch)
tree27c0b34292aba4b214fbf7fa23a86a90f1847b1e
parent375e27644a597bc0d3c9c45ff5ffc06bb74a6d05 (diff)
downloadaur-suil-git.tar.gz
Use correct license name and provide 'suil-docs'
-rw-r--r--.SRCINFO6
-rw-r--r--PKGBUILD11
2 files changed, 11 insertions, 6 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 0549fceeb6e5..ba3bf46e30ea 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,10 +1,10 @@
pkgbase = suil-git
pkgdesc = Lightweight C library for loading and wrapping LV2 plugin UIs (git version)
pkgver = 0.10.16.r414.78bf2c7
- pkgrel = 1
+ pkgrel = 2
url = http://drobilla.net/software/suil/
arch = x86_64
- license = custom:ISC
+ license = ISC
makedepends = doxygen
makedepends = git
makedepends = gtk2
@@ -20,6 +20,7 @@ pkgbase = suil-git
optdepends = qt5-base: Qt 5.x UI wrapping support
provides = suil
provides = suil=0.10.16
+ provides = suil-docs
conflicts = suil
conflicts = suil-svn
source = suil::git+https://gitlab.com/lv2/suil.git
@@ -28,4 +29,5 @@ pkgbase = suil-git
pkgname = suil-git
provides = suil
provides = suil=0.10.16
+ provides = suil-docs
provides = libsuil-0.so
diff --git a/PKGBUILD b/PKGBUILD
index 5478a002cb2d..853adf00ba81 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,11 +3,11 @@
_pkgname=suil
pkgname="$_pkgname-git"
pkgver=0.10.16.r414.78bf2c7
-pkgrel=1
+pkgrel=2
pkgdesc='Lightweight C library for loading and wrapping LV2 plugin UIs (git version)'
arch=(x86_64)
url='http://drobilla.net/software/suil/'
-license=('custom:ISC')
+license=(ISC)
makedepends=(
doxygen
git
@@ -23,7 +23,7 @@ makedepends=(
optdepends=('gtk2: GTK+ 2.x UI wrapping support'
'gtk3: GTK+ 3.x UI wrapping support'
'qt5-base: Qt 5.x UI wrapping support')
-provides=($_pkgname "$_pkgname=${pkgver//.r*/}")
+provides=($_pkgname "$_pkgname=${pkgver//.r*/}" $_pkgname-docs)
conflicts=($_pkgname $_pkgname-svn)
source=("$_pkgname::git+https://gitlab.com/lv2/$_pkgname.git")
md5sums=('SKIP')
@@ -47,7 +47,10 @@ build() {
package() {
provides+=(libsuil-0.so)
meson install -C $_pkgname-build --destdir "$pkgdir"
- mv -v "$pkgdir"/usr/share/doc/{$_pkgname-0,$pkgname}
+ # license
install -vDm 644 $_pkgname/COPYING -t "$pkgdir"/usr/share/licenses/$pkgname
+ # documentation
+ mv -v "$pkgdir"/usr/share/doc/{$_pkgname-0,$pkgname}
+ rm "$pkgdir"/usr/share/doc/$pkgname/{single,}html/.buildinfo
install -vDm 644 $_pkgname/{AUTHORS,NEWS,README.md} -t "$pkgdir"/usr/share/doc/$pkgname
}